This skilled position requires advanced knowledge of electricity, plumbing, and movable equipment. It requires minimal supervision and supports large hospital campuses. The Maintenance Mechanic II operates, maintains, and repairs various electrical/plumbing systems and movable equipment. The role utilizes exceptional customer service and communication skills to ensure a safe working environment and support an exceptional Environment of Care for Mercy.

Responsibilities

Operate, maintain, and repair electrical/plumbing systems and movable equipment across large hospital campuses with minimal supervision.

Communicate with customers, read and understand technical manuals, and perform calculations for testing, installation, measurement, estimation, and repair of equipment.

Use computer software such as Outlook, TMS, or Nuvolo, prioritize work assignments, manage time and materials efficiently, and document work assignments in a high‑quality manner at the lowest cost to Mercy.

Achieve favorable results on both oral and written competency exam before advancing to Maintenance Mechanic III.
